欢迎访问宙启技术站
智能推送

Python函数教程:初学者必知的基本函数

发布时间:2023-06-20 01:13:59

Python是一种高级编程语言,其强大的功能和易于使用的语法使它成为 的编程语言之一。在Python中,函数是一组执行特定任务的语句,可以在程序中的多个地方重复使用。本文将介绍初学者必知的基本函数。

1. print函数

这是最基本的函数之一,它用于输出文本。可以向print函数传递任意数量的参数,参数之间用逗号分隔。当调用print函数时,它将自动在每个参数之间添加空格,并在末尾添加换行符。

示例:

print("Hello, World!")
print("My name is", "John", "Doe")

输出:

Hello, World!
My name is John Doe

2. input函数

input函数用于获取用户输入。当调用input函数时,程序将停止执行,并等待用户输入数据。用户输入数据后,程序将继续执行,并将输入数据作为字符串返回。

示例:

name = input("What is your name? ")
print("Hello, " + name + "!")

输出:

What is your name? John
Hello, John!

3. len函数

len函数用于获取字符串、列表、元组和字典等对象的长度。当调用len函数时,它将返回对象的元素数量。

示例:

name = "John Doe"
print(len(name))

numbers = [1, 2, 3, 4, 5]
print(len(numbers))

输出:

8
5

4. range函数

range函数用于生成一个数字序列,可以用于循环和列表生成式中。range函数的三个参数分别是起始值、结束值和步长。起始值和步长是可选的,默认为0和1。

示例:

for i in range(5):
    print(i)

for i in range(1, 10, 2):
    print(i)

输出:

0
1
2
3
4
1
3
5
7
9

5. round函数

round函数用于将浮点数四舍五入到指定的精度。当调用round函数时, 个参数是要四舍五入的浮点数,第二个参数是精度。精度的默认值为0。

示例:

print(round(3.14159))
print(round(3.14159, 2))
print(round(3.14159, 3))

输出:

3
3.14
3.142

6. abs函数

abs函数用于返回一个数的绝对值。当调用abs函数时,它将返回一个数的绝对值。

示例:

print(abs(-5))
print(abs(5))

输出:

5
5

7. max函数和min函数

max函数和min函数分别用于获取一组值中的最大值和最小值。当调用max函数时,它将返回一组值中的最大值。当调用min函数时,它将返回一组值中的最小值。

示例:

numbers = [1, 2, 3, 4, 5]
print(max(numbers))
print(min(numbers))

输出:

5
1

8. sorted函数

sorted函数用于对列表或元组进行排序。当调用sorted函数时,它将返回一个排序后的列表或元组。

示例:

numbers = [3, 2, 1, 4, 5]
print(sorted(numbers))

输出:

[1, 2, 3, 4, 5]

9. sum函数

sum函数用于计算列表或元组中所有数的和。当调用sum函数时,它将返回列表或元组中所有数的和。

示例:

numbers = [1, 2, 3, 4, 5]
print(sum(numbers))

输出:

15

10. type函数

type函数用于获取一个对象的类型。当调用type函数时,它将返回一个对象的类型。

示例:

name = "John Doe"
numbers = [1, 2, 3, 4, 5]

print(type(name))
print(type(numbers))

输出:

<class 'str'>
<class 'list'>

总结

本文介绍了初学者必知的10个Python基本函数,包括print、input、len、range、round、abs、max、min、sorted和sum。这些函数是Python编程中最常用的函数之一。有了这些函数的基础知识,初学者可以更好地理解Python编程语言的基础知识。